Ticket: Staging env misconfigured for Siftgate bloom filter

The bloom layer in front of the Pellet KV store is rejecting all lookups in staging because the env file was copied from the dev template without credentials. False-positive tuning values are fine; only the auth line is missing. To unblock the weekly demo, the Pellet admission secret must be set on the following line.

env line for yaguf-fajop: LEDGER_TOKEN13=fb08984397349

## 2024-07-11 — Key rotation (Lagwatch)

Heads up: we rotated the signing key used by the Lagwatch read-replica lag alarm after last week's false-page storm. The alarm itself is unchanged — still fires when replica delay on the Quillhaven cluster exceeds 45s for three consecutive checks. If you get paged tonight, trust it; the flappy threshold bug is fixed. Old key is revoked as of this deploy. The new key for verifying alarm payloads is below.

deploy key for hawef-yadup: bky19_kVT4YunTZZSTyhFQQoK

Handover Note — Lease Renegotiation, Harwick Depot

From outgoing director Maren Ilves to incoming director Tobias Crell, for board record. Negotiations with the landlord, Penfold Estates, have reached a third draft: a seven-year term with a break clause at year four and stepped rent increases capped at 2.5% annually. Legal review by Quarrow & Bale is pending. The board should weigh this against our relocation option, outlined confidentially below.

board note of yajog-bahop: The steering committee signed off on a budget of $236.5 million for Project Raleth.